### Describe the bug

When a custom agent is selected via `/agent` (or `--agent=`), the agent profile's instructions are loaded into the session system prompt context as `` block.
After `/compact` runs (either manually or via automatic compaction at ~80-95% context), the `` block is stripped from the context and not restored.

This effectively discards the custom agent's persona, behavioral rules, guidelines, and all other instructions -- making the `/agent` selection meaningless after compaction.

### Steps to reproduce the behavior

### Steps to reproduce

1. Create a custom agent profile at `~/.copilot/agents/my-agent.agent.md` with disable-model-invocation: true and substantial instructions
2. Launch copilot and select the agent via `/agent`
3. Verify the agent instructions are active (e.g., the model follows behaviour defined in the custom agent file)
4. Have a conversation long enough to trigger automatic compaction, or run /compact manually
5. Observe that the model no longer follows the custom agent instructions
6. Ask the model to check its system prompt — the `` block is absent

### Expected behavior

### Expected behavior

The system prompt's `` block from the selected custom agent profile should survive compaction. It is session configuration, not conversational history — it should be treated equivalently to `.github/copilot-instructions.md` or instruction files, which persist across compaction.

### Actual behavior

The block is discarded during compaction. The model reverts to default behavior without the custom agent's rules.
